I started collecting thin sections about 20 years ago. I went to a Gem show
and saw Bob Haag with a large number of thin sections.  At that time I tried
to an individual and slice of each meteorite in my collection. Seeing all of
Bob's thin sections got me thinking that perhaps I should collect thin
sections to complement the individuals and slices in my collection.
	I left the gem show and drove directly to a microscope dealer's
showroom.  In less than a half hour I left the showroom with a polarizing
stage new base and a fiber optic "light pipe". These accessories allowed me
to turn me reflected light Unitron microscope into a polarizing microscope.
	 I then drove back to the gem show.  At Bob's table I selected an
Allende CV3 and a Murchison CM2. You can probably guess that I have a thing
for carbonaceous chondrites. Before I left Bob gave me a Ragland L3. From
this start I have added hundreds of thin sections to my collection.
